Conejos River

The Conejos River is one of the most scenic and peaceful spots in La Jara. It’s a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ts, and you can take a relaxing float or kayaking trip on the river. You can also spend some time exploring the area by horseback. This area is rich in natural beauty, and it has something for everyone.

The Rio Grande National Forest is located near La Jara, and the Conejos River flows through it. The river is home to rainbow, cutthroat, and brook trout. You can also catch a variety of species of bass and trout in nearby lakes and streams. The area is also home to elk, black bears, and mountain lions. La Jara is also home to several other parks and preserves. The La Jara Basin is an ecologically diverse region that is linked to the upper Rio Grande. In fact, the area includes 30 miles of perennial cold-water streams that are home to Rio Grande cutthroat trout. Other outdoor recreation sites include the La Jara Creek, Jim Creek, and Torsido Creek. The area is also home to several Colorado State Wildlife Areas.
